What You'll Learn
Embark on a transformative journey with the Global Certificate in Blockchain Encryption and Cryptographic Hashes, designed to equip you with cutting-edge skills in blockchain technology. This comprehensive programme delves into the intricacies of encryption algorithms and cryptographic hashes, providing a solid foundation in the principles and practices that underpin secure and transparent blockchain networks.
Key topics include the fundamentals of cryptography, such as symmetric and asymmetric encryption, hash functions, and digital signatures. You will also explore advanced concepts like zero-knowledge proofs and cryptographic protocols, gaining a deep understanding of how these technologies ensure data security and integrity.
